Anger is a negative emotion that can follow frustration, disappointment, and injustice. It can vary from mild and short-term to intense and long-term.
w
PROVERBS 15:1 A soft answer turneth away wrath:but grievous wo rds stir up anger.

PROVERBS 15:18 A wrathful man stirreth up strife: but he that is slow to anger appeaseth strife.

I think it is in Ecc 3 that it is said there is a season for everything. Hate is not listed, but war and hate are.

Eph 4:26 says be ye angry and sin not. Let not the sun go down upon your wrath.

We are in the flesh and I believe that we will be angry at times. Its just a matter of how we handle it.
